Insulated Engineering Workshop for Dairy Producer, Wiltshire

Dairy Producer

Background 

A building contractor Stancold regularly works with contacted the Food Projects team to assist with a project at a Wiltshire dairy facility.

The dairy producer wanted to line their engineering workshop with hygienic whitewall panelling to match the rest of the facility and to insulate it against external temperatures. They also required the installation of an office space in the workshop for their engineers.

Food production sites often have an engineering workshop separate from the production and product storage areas. In many cases this is for the maintenance of site machinery.

Process

The Stancold Food Projects team collaborated with the main contractor and the end user to develop an optimal design for the engineering space.

The design had to account for an existing roller door in the engineering space.

Project Delivery

Stancold efficiently installed the insulated engineering workshop and office space using Kingspan panelling, ensuring it not only matched the rest of the facility but also provided improved warmth for the engineers during the colder months.

The design and installation also incorporated an opening for the existing roller door and two hinged personnel doors for staff access.

The nature of the panels serves to not only provide consistency with the rest of the site, but also insulate the engineers from external temperatures.
